Old Milestone by the B3123, Church Road, Alphington

Image: © Alan Rosevear Taken: 16 Apr 2011

Carved stone post by the B3123 (was A38), in parish of EXETER (EXETER District), Church Road, Alphington, between Blenheim Road and Legion Way, built into wall of garden, in recess, on South side of road. Exeter granite facets, erected by the Exeter turnpike trust in the 19th century. Inscription reads:- : 9 / Miles to / Chudleigh / 1 / Mile to / Exeter : : 177 / Miles / to / London : : 1 / Mile to / Exeter / 9 / Miles to / Chudleigh : Grade II listed. List Entry Number: 1440322 https://historicengland.org.uk/listing/the-list/list-entry/1440322 Milestone Society National ID: DV_EXCH01.
